To examine initiation and prescribing patterns of metformin-glibenclamide and metformin-rosiglitazone fixed dose combination products within the Australian veteran population.
A retrospective observational study using Department of Veterans' Affairs pharmacy claims data. We examined overall trends in the utilisation and proportion of patients who had been previously dispensed both, one, or none of the individual ingredient products before initiating combination products.
Of metformin-glibenclamide initiations, 9% involved a switch from metformin and glibenclamide as separate products, while 22% had used neither metformin nor a sulfonylurea. Thirty percent of metformin-rosiglitazone initiations involved a switch from both individual products, while in 10% neither metformin nor thiazolidinedione had been dispensed.
A minority of veterans started taking the combination products after being stabilised on the individual products; many had no prior history of oral hypoglycaemic use. This prescribing may lead to wastage if combination medications are poorly tolerated or, more importantly, may cause adverse events.
研究澳大利亚退伍军人中二甲双胍-格列本脲和二甲双胍-罗格列酮固定剂量复方制剂的起始用药及处方模式。
一项使用退伍军人事务部药房报销数据的回顾性观察研究。我们研究了在开始使用复方制剂之前,曾被配给过两种单一成分产品之一或两种都未被配给过的患者的使用总体趋势和比例。
在开始使用二甲双胍-格列本脲的患者中,9%是从单独使用二甲双胍和格列本脲转换而来,而22%既未使用过二甲双胍也未使用过磺脲类药物。开始使用二甲双胍-罗格列酮的患者中,30%是从两种单一成分产品转换而来,而10%既未配给过二甲双胍也未配给过噻唑烷二酮类药物。
少数退伍军人在单一成分产品使用稳定后开始服用复方制剂;许多人既往无口服降糖药使用史。如果复方药物耐受性差,这种处方可能导致浪费,或者更重要的是,可能会引起不良事件。
